Role Overview

The Patient Intake Specialist owns the front-end execution of healthcare intake workflows, ensuring patient records, documentation, and provider details are accurate, complete, and compliant before moving downstream.

This role is detail-intensive and process-driven, combining high-volume data management with proactive coordination across patients, providers, and internal teams. You’ll act as a critical operational checkpoint—protecting data integrity, ensuring HIPAA compliance, and preventing downstream delays that affect patient care and service delivery.

This role is ideal for healthcare operators who thrive in structured environments, excel at quality control, and take pride in precision, follow-through, and operational discipline.

Core ResponsibilitiesData Management & Quality Control — 35%
  • Perform high-volume data entry and management of patient records and healthcare datasets
  • Ensure completeness, accuracy, and consistency across intake systems
  • Review incoming forms and documentation for errors or missing information
  • Create clean, accurate base records prior to downstream processing
  • Conduct detailed QA checks against provider-specific requirements
  • Verify patient demographics, insurance details, and medical histories
  • Maintain EHR and database hygiene through cleanup and deduplication
  • Monitor workflows to proactively identify discrepancies or risks
Provider Research & Coordination — 25%
  • Identify all providers and facilities involved in patient care
  • Research billing providers, networks, and healthcare entities
  • Verify provider credentials, participation, and submission requirements
  • Document and maintain accurate provider records in internal systems
  • Navigate provider portals and healthcare databases efficiently
  • Coordinate directly with providers to resolve missing or unclear information
  • Track non-standard provider requirements and escalate when needed
Intake Processing & Request Management — 20%
  • Process patient intake requests and Release of Information (ROI) forms
  • Build complete, submission-ready documentation packets
  • Assign requests based on workload, priority, and specialization
  • Ensure clean handoffs to downstream teams with complete context
  • Track intake requests through defined stages and SLAs
  • Manage scheduling data and maintain updated patient/provider records
  • Handle volume spikes and priority shifts with accuracy and urgency
Compliance & Process Adherence — 10%
  • Maintain strict HIPAA compliance in all workflows
  • Follow SOPs for data handling, documentation, and communication
  • Identify compliance risks and escalate appropriately
